The Club with Leo Damrosch
Virtual presentation given for the Athenaeum of Philadelphia on October 29, 2020. Leo Damrosch is the author of The Club: Johnson, Boswell, and the Friends Who Shaped An Age Leo Damrosch will recreate a celebrated eighteenth-century London club whose members met at the Turks Head Tavern to eat, drink, and enthusiastically argue. At its center was Samuel Johnson, and thanks to his friend and future biographer James Boswell, we have unusually rich accounts of their discussions. Damrosch’s talk will also range beyond those weekly meetings to illuminate the larger careers of many of the members. Johnson is arguably the greatest British critic of all time and Boswell the greatest biographer; other members included Edward Gibbon, the greatest historian, Edmund Burke, the greatest orator and political thinker, and Adam Smith, virtual founder of the discipline of economics. Among others in this constellation of talent were Joshua Reynolds, the leading painter of his day, and David Garrick, groundbreaking actor and theatrical director.
